{{- $page := .page }}
{{- $location := .location }}
{{- if eq $location "footer" }}
  {{- with $page }}
    {{- $assetBusting := partialCached "assetbusting.gotmpl" . }}
    <script src="{{"js/js-yaml.min.js" | relURL}}{{ $assetBusting }}" defer></script>
    {{- $urlOpenapi := "" }}
    {{- $relOpenapi := "" }}
    {{- $cssInProject := false }}
    {{- if and (isset .Params "customopenapiurl") .Params.customOpenapiURL }}
      {{- $urlOpenapi = .Params.customOpenapiURL }}
      {{- $relOpenapi = .Params.customOpenapiURL }}
    {{- else if and (isset .Site.Params "customopenapiurl") .Site.Params.customOpenapiURL }}
      {{- $urlOpenapi = .Site.Params.customOpenapiURL }}
      {{- $relOpenapi = .Site.Params.customOpenapiURL }}
    {{- else }}
      {{- $urlOpenapi = printf "%s%s" ("js/swagger-ui/swagger-ui-bundle.js" | relURL) $assetBusting }}
      {{- $relOpenapi = printf "%s%s" ("/js/swagger-ui/swagger-ui-bundle.js") $assetBusting }}
      {{- $cssInProject = true }}
      {{- end }}
    <script>window.noZensmooth = true;</script>
    <script src="{{ $urlOpenapi }}" defer></script>
    {{- $urlOpenapi := replace $urlOpenapi "swagger-ui-bundle" "swagger-ui-standalone-preset" }}
    <script src="{{ $urlOpenapi }}" defer></script>
    {{- $relOpenapi := replace $relOpenapi "swagger-ui-bundle" "swagger-ui" }}
    {{- $relOpenapi := replace $relOpenapi ".js" ".css" }}
    <script>
      window.themeUseOpenapi = { css: {{ $relOpenapi }}, cssInProject: {{ $cssInProject | safeJS }}, assetsBuster: "{{ $assetBusting }}" };
    </script>
  {{- end }}
{{- end }}